About Max Wagenknecht

  • Max Otto Arnold Wagenknecht (14 August 1857 – 7 May 1922) was a German composer of organ and piano music.
  • He was born in Woldisch Tychow, Pomerania, Free State of Prussia and spent most of his life in the Mecklenburg-Western Pomerania region where he was music teacher at the Franzburg Teachers’ College and in his later life organist and composer in Anklam.
  • He is most well known for Opus 5, “58 Vor- und Nachspiele”, completed in July 1889 in Franzburg.
  • The work demonstrates a remarkable gift for melodic organ compositions bridging traditional church music and the late 19th century romantic music era.
